Project management is a demanding field that requires exceptional skills in planning, organizing, and managing teams to achieve goals. An assistant project manager plays a crucial role in the success of a project by supporting the project manager in various aspects of project planning and management.

As an assistant project manager, you will have to manage project schedules, liaise with clients, stakeholders and team members, and ensure that projects are delivered within the set budget and timeline. Your role will vary depending on the organization or the project you are working on, but you should be prepared to take on any task assigned to you.

The good news is that there are plenty of assistant project manager contract jobs available in various industries, including construction, IT, healthcare, and finance. These contract jobs offer flexibility, short-term commitments, and competitive pay rates.

One of the advantages of working as an assistant project manager on a contract basis is the opportunity to gain experience and exposure to different industries and project types. With each new contract job, you will learn new skills, techniques, and methods that you can apply to future projects.

Another benefit of assistant project manager contract jobs is the potential for advancement. Many assistant project managers start their careers on a contract basis and move on to permanent positions within the same organization or industry. This is a great way to build a strong network of contacts and establish yourself as a skilled and experienced project manager.

To succeed as an assistant project manager on a contract basis, you must have excellent communication, organizational, and time management skills. You should be comfortable working with different types of people, managing conflicting priorities, and adapting to changing circumstances.
